Two different Peorias
| Area | Typical vehicle | What we usually check first |
|---|---|---|
| Central / south Peoria | Older Priuses, long-owned Camry Hybrids | Block-level pack testing and cooling intake condition — these are cars where age and heat have accumulated. |
| North Peoria / Vistancia | Newer RAV4, Highlander and Camry hybrids | 12V battery and sensor faults first — a degraded pack would be early on these vehicles, and factory coverage may still apply. |
Long commutes from the north end
- Lake Pleasant Parkway down to the 101 and on into central Phoenix is a substantial daily drive, and it adds up fast.
- High annual mileage tends to produce even pack ageing across the whole battery rather than a single weak block.
- If your commute involves a lot of stop-and-go on the 101 at rush hour, that's harder on the pack than steady freeway running.
- Newer vehicles on this route are worth checking against Toyota's hybrid coverage before any paid repair.
